I'll still believe it when I see it but David Zatz just posted up on AllPar that Sergio Marchionne confirmed in front of a "select media" that a Jeep Wrangler Pickup "will be built" and is slated to appear by the end of 2017. This of course would put the rumored release of it about a year sooner that was originally rumored but if what Sergio Marchionne said can really be confirmed outside of AllPar, this could be really big news!

The photo below is a spy photo that Allpar included.
